Engaging Compassion Through Intent and Action shares resources and reveals clues to building and sustaining a personal, compassion-centric bridge. We begin by laying a strong foundation of awareness and sinking life pillars of being present, understanding our self, living with curious daring, and taking a long look at our life into that foundation. Our bridge’s cables are mindfulness practices that anchor us in the moment and help us to release life stressors. We lay our bridge’s deck through our intent and action.
Ready to engage compassion? Use the ideas and tools presented to gain an expanded awareness of your self. Develop a greater understanding of the underlying reasons why you react and respond to the world. Using the process of RI2 (reflection, introspection, and integration) shift from a place of fear-filled reaction to a place of compassionate response. The result? A compassion-centric life bridged through the alignment of your intent with your actions.
Vanessa Hurst, author of Engaging Compassion Through Intent And Action, is a member of the Coordinating Circle for Compassionate Louisville. She writes for Contemplative Journal and facilitates retreats, workshops, and seminars regionally. Vanessa holds a master’s degree in Natural Health. As a practicing contemplative for over 21 years, compassion shared with her self, others, and all of creation is the natural rhythm of her life. In her practice as an intuitive healer and spiritual mentor, Vanessa understands that living with compassion is the foundation of healing both individuals and the world.
